GPU comparison with benchmarksThe MSI GeForce GT 1030 2GHD4 LP OC has 384 shader units and these clock a maximum of 1.43 GHz which results in an FP32 computing power of 1.10 TFLOPS.
The EVGA GeForce GTX 1050 Ti SSC GAMING has 768 shader units and these clock at a maximum of 1.48 GHz and achieve an FP32 computing power of 2.28 TFLOPS. |

MemoryThe MSI GeForce GT 1030 2GHD4 LP OC is equipped with a 2 GB large DDR4 graphics memory, which is equipped with 1.050 GHz clocks. The EVGA GeForce GTX 1050 Ti SSC GAMING has a 4 GB large GDDR5 graphics memory and the memory clock is 1.752GHz. |
||
2 GB | Memory Size | 4 GB |
DDR4 | Memory Type | GDDR5 |
1.050 GHz | Memory Clock | 1.752 GHz |
2.1 Gbps | Memory Speed | 7.0 Gbps |
17 GB/s | Memory bandwidth | 112 GB/s |
64 bit | Memory Interface | 128 bit |

Supported Video CodecsThis area lists which video codecs can be decoded or encoded by the graphics cards in hardware. As a result, the power consumption can be reduced due to a lower processor load. |
||
Decode | h264 | Decode / Encode |
Decode | h265 / HEVC | Decode / Encode |
No | AV1 | No |
No | VP8 | No |
Decode | VP9 | Decode |
